    The Iowa Association of Business and Industry has elected Kathryn Kunert, vice president of economic connections and integration at MidAmerican Energy, to chair its Board of Directors for the 2026-27 term.

    Ms. Kunert, a Mason City native and University of Northern Iowa graduate, has spent three decades at MidAmerican Energy, where she leads efforts to strengthen ties between businesses, communities and economic development partners statewide.

    She has held leadership roles with a range of statewide organizations, including the Iowa Governor’s STEM Advisory Council, Iowa Innovation Corporation, the Future Ready Iowa Alliance and the Cultivation Corridor. Ms. Kunert previously chaired the Greater Des Moines Partnership Board of Directors and has been named a Woman of Influence and Forty Under 40 honoree by the Business Record, which later recognized her as a Forty Under 40 Alumnus of the Year.

    “Kathryn is an accomplished business leader who understands the importance of building strong partnerships and creating opportunities for Iowa employers,” said Nicole Crain, ABI president in a statement. “She has spent her career bringing together business, community and government leaders to advance Iowa’s economy. Her collaborative leadership and strategic perspective will help guide ABI as we continue advocating for a strong business climate and a vibrant economy.”

    ABI members also elected the following officers to the 2026-27 Executive Committee:

    • Vice chair: Tim Bianco, Iowa Spring Manufacturing Inc. (Adel)
    • Treasurer: Nate Weaton, Weaton Companies (Fairfield)
    • Secretary: Mike Espeset, Story Construction (Ames)
    • Immediate past chair: Kellan Longenecker, General Mills (Avon)

    Brad Nielsen of Iowa American Water (Davenport) and Gretchen Spear of International Paper (Cedar Rapids) will return to the Executive Committee. Newly elected members are Stacey Pellett of John Deere (West Des Moines), Eric Moerman of Interstates (Sioux Center) and Andrew St. John of CIPCO (Des Moines).

    Four new members joined ABI’s Board of Directors:

    • Jill Bidwell, Emerson (Marshalltown)
    • Devin Boyer, Nicolet National Bank (West Des Moines)
    • Tom Mangan, Sukup Manufacturing Company (Sheffield)
    • Scott Schurman, Downing Construction (Indianola)
